Сегодня, когда каждый человек имеет возможность создать свой собственный веб-сайт, важным становится правильный выбор инструмента для этой задачи. HTML редакторы – это те волшебные палитры, которые позволяют нам преобразовать идеи в реальность, формируя структуру, стиль и содержание наших онлайн-проектов. Давайте погрузимся в удивительный мир HTML редакторов, их функций и возможностей, чтобы вы могли найти именно тот инструмент, который поможет вам на вашем пути в веб-разработке.
Что такое HTML редактор?
HTML editor – это специализированный программный инструмент, который упрощает процесс написания и редактирования кода HTML. Он может быть как отдельным приложением, так и частью более комплексных систем, таких как интегрированные среды разработки (IDE). Основная цель HTML редактора – предоставить пользователю удобный интерфейс для создания и изменения кода, обеспечивая при этом подсказки, автозаполнение и другие полезные функции.
Существует множество HTML редакторов, которые различаются по функциональности, интерфейсу и целевой аудитории. Некоторые из них подходят для новичков, предоставляя простой интерфейс и удобные инструменты, тогда как другие предназначены для опытных разработчиков, предлагая множество продвинутых возможностей и настроек. Но зачем углубляться в такое разнообразие? Давайте поговорим о типах HTML редакторов.
Типы HTML редакторов
HTML редакторы можно условно разделить на несколько категорий. Каждая из них предназначена для определённых нужд и уровней подготовки пользователя. Рассмотрим более подробно каждую из категорий:
1. WYSIWYG редакторы
WYSIWYG (What You See Is What You Get) редакторы предназначены для пользователей, которые не имеют глубоких знаний в кодировании. Они позволяют вам видеть, что вы делаете, в реальном времени, практически как при работе с текстовым процессором. Вы можете добавлять текст, изображения и другие элементы, а редактор автоматически генерирует HTML-код.
Плюсы | Минусы |
---|---|
Простота в использовании | Ограниченные возможности настройки |
Визуальное представление | Код может быть не оптимальным |
Отлично для начинающих | Меньше контроля над кодом |
2. Текстовые редакторы
Текстовые редакторы – это более традиционный подход к редактированию HTML. Они допускают ручной ввод кода и предполагают, что пользователь знает, что делает. Примеры таких редакторов включают Notepad++, Sublime Text и Atom. Эти инструменты предлагают множество функций, таких как подсветка синтаксиса, автозаполнение и поддержка плагинов.
Плюсы | Минусы |
---|---|
Больше контроля над кодом | Требует навыков программирования |
Гибкость и расширяемость | Не всегда интуитивно понятно для новичков |
3. Интегрированные среды разработки (IDE)
IDE представляют собой комплексные программные продукты, которые объединяют функции редакторов и много других инструментов, таких как отладчики, системы управления версиями и т.д. IDE идеально подходят для профессиональных разработчиков, которые работают над крупными проектами. Примеры IDE включают Visual Studio Code, WebStorm и Eclipse.
Плюсы | Минусы |
---|---|
Полный набор инструментов | Сложность в изучении |
Поддержка различных языков программирования | Требует больше ресурсов системы |
Как выбрать HTML редактор?
Выбор HTML редактора зависит от нескольких факторов, включая ваш уровень подготовки, цели и предпочтения в работе. Вот несколько моментов, которые стоит учесть при выборе:
- Уровень подготовки. Если вы новичок, лучше начинать с WYSIWYG редактора. Если у вас уже есть опыт, текстовый редактор или IDE будут более подходящими.
- Цели работы. Если вы планируете создавать простые веб-страницы, возможно вам будет достаточно простого текстового редактора. Для сложных проектов лучше использовать IDE.
- Функциональность. Оцените, какие функции вам жизненно необходимы, например, подсветка синтаксиса, автозаполнение или поддержка плагинов.
- Интерфейс. Убедитесь, что интерфейс редактора вам удобен и интуитивно понятен. Это может значительно улучшить ваш опыт работы.
Популярные HTML редакторы
Сейчас на рынке представлено множество HTML редакторов. Чтобы облегчить вам задачу выбора, рассмотри несколько наиболее популярных из них:
1. Visual Studio Code
Visual Studio Code – это бесплатный и открытый редактор от Microsoft, который зарекомендовал себя среди веб-разработчиков. Он поддерживает множество языков программирования, включая HTML, CSS и JavaScript. Основные его преимущества – это гибкость, настраиваемость и богатый ассортимент плагинов, позволяющих расширять его функциональность. Однако для новичков он может показаться немного сложным, но с практикой все становится проще!
2. Sublime Text
Sublime Text – это быстрый, легкий и многофункциональный текстовый редактор, который поддерживает множество языков и расширений. Основные его достоинства – отличная производительность и простота использования, но с ограниченной бесплатной версией. Пользователи отмечают высокую скорость работы и минималистичный интерфейс.
3. Brackets
Brackets – бесплатный редактор с фокусом на веб-разработку. Он предлагает функции реального времени так, чтобы вы могли видеть изменения на своем сайте мгновенно. Это особенно полезно для новичков, которые ищут дружелюбный интерфейс и простоту.
4. Atom
Atom – это редактор, созданный GitHub, который делает акцент на кастомизации. Он гибкий и предназначен для разработчиков, которые хотят создавать собственные плагины и темы. Однако потребление оперативной памяти может быть немного высоким, это стоит учитывать перед установкой.
Советы по работе с HTML редакторами
Чтобы сделать ваше взаимодействие с HTML редакторами более эффективным и продуктивным, вот несколько полезных советов:
- Изучите горячие клавиши: Знание комбинаций клавиш может значительно ускорить вашу работу.
- Используйте расширения: Многие редакторы, такие как Visual Studio Code и Atom, имеют огромное количество расширений, которые могут улучшить ваш опыт работы.
- Сохраните структуру кода: Хорошая структура и комментарии в коде помогут вам и вашим коллегам быстрее разобраться в вашем проекте.
- Регулярно проверяйте ли код: Используйте встроенные функции проверки кода для обнаружения ошибок на ранних этапах, чтобы избежать проблем в будущем.
Заключение
HTML редакторы – это мощные инструменты, которые могут значительно упростить процесс разработки веб-сайтов. Выбор редактора зависит от ваших потребностей, опыта и целей, но независимо от того, какой инструмент вы выберете, важно продолжать учиться и развиваться в этой интересной области. Создание веб-страниц – это не только написание кода, но и реализация идей, развитие креативности и исследование новых технологий.
Надеемся, что наша статья была полезна и помогла вам лучше понять мир HTML редакторов. Попробуйте различные инструменты, экспериментируйте и находите тот, который идеально подходит именно вам. Удачи в создании ваших великолепных веб-проектов!